.blog-filterable{position:relative}.blog-filterable__wrapper{display:flex;flex-direction:column}.blog-filterable__header{text-align:center}.blog-filterable__heading{margin:0}.blog-filterable__filters{display:flex;flex-wrap:wrap;gap:1.2rem;justify-content:center;align-items:center;margin:2rem 0}@media screen and (max-width:749px){.blog-filterable__filters{gap:1rem}}.filter-button{display:flex;align-items:center;gap:.8rem;padding:.8rem 1.2rem;border:.2rem solid rgb(var(--color-foreground));background-color:transparent;color:rgb(var(--color-foreground));font-family:var(--font-heading-family);font-size:1.8rem;font-weight:500;line-height:1;text-transform:uppercase;text-decoration:none;border-radius:var(--buttons-radius);cursor:pointer;transition:all .2s ease;white-space:nowrap}@media screen and (max-width:749px){.filter-button{padding:0 1rem;font-size:1.4rem;gap:.6rem}}.filter-button:hover{background-color:var(--yellow);color:rgb(var(--color-background));text-decoration:underline}.filter-button:focus-visible{outline:.2rem solid rgb(var(--color-foreground));outline-offset:.3rem}.filter-button--active{background-color:var(--yellow);text-decoration:none}.filter-button__icon{display:flex;align-items:center;justify-content:center;width:3.2rem;height:3.2rem;flex-shrink:0}@media screen and (max-width:749px){.filter-button__icon{width:2rem;height:2rem}}.filter-button__icon img,.filter-button__icon svg{width:100%;height:100%}.filter-button__text{line-height:1}.filter-button__text-only{display:flex;align-items:center;justify-content:center;min-width:3.2rem;padding:.3rem .8rem 0}.blog-filterable__active-label{font-family:var(--font-heading-family);font-size:clamp(2rem,3vw,3rem);text-transform:uppercase;letter-spacing:.02em;margin:0;padding:0}.blog-filterable__grid{display:grid;grid-template-columns:repeat(2,1fr);gap:2rem;list-style:none;margin:0;padding:0}@media screen and (min-width:750px){.blog-filterable__grid{grid-template-columns:repeat(3,1fr)}}@media screen and (min-width:990px){.blog-filterable__grid{grid-template-columns:repeat(4,1fr)}}.blog-filterable__grid-item{display:flex}.blog-filterable__grid-item .blog-card{width:100%}.blog-filterable__empty{grid-column:1 / -1;text-align:center;padding:6rem 2rem;color:rgb(var(--color-foreground));font-size:2rem}
/*# sourceMappingURL=/cdn/shop/t/135/assets/section-main-blog-filterable.css.map */
